The term "packmen" has a rich historical significance and diverse meanings, primarily rooted in trade and commerce. Traditionally, "packmen" refers to itinerant traders who sold goods from packs, often traveling from town to town. This term is derived from the Old English word "pæcca," meaning a bundle or package. The role of packmen has evolved over centuries, and their significance can be understood through various contexts.

Historically, packmen were crucial in communities, especially in rural areas where access to goods could be limited. They played a vital role in the distribution of products such as textiles, tools, and other essential items. Typically, these traders would carry their items on their backs or in baskets, making their way through towns and villages. As such, they helped in the flow of commerce and were often the primary link between producers and consumers.
